The Root Causes of America's Truck Size Problem
The current truck size problem in the US isn't a single issue but rather a convergence of factors. Understanding these underlying causes is crucial to developing effective solutions.
Increased Freight Demand
The boom in e-commerce has dramatically increased freight demand, fueling the need for larger trucks with greater large truck capacity. This surge in online shopping necessitates efficient delivery systems, often leading to the use of bigger vehicles to handle increased volumes. The complexities of today's supply chains, particularly the challenges of last-mile delivery, further exacerbate this trend, favoring larger trucks for greater efficiency. This trend is amplified by the rise of mega-carriers, who prioritize economies of scale, often deploying fleets of massive trucks.
- Increased online shopping: The shift from brick-and-mortar retail to online marketplaces necessitates significant increases in freight transportation.
- Supply chain complexities: Globalized supply chains demand more efficient and high-capacity transportation, pushing the limits of current infrastructure.
- Last-mile delivery challenges: The final leg of delivery often requires trucks to navigate congested urban areas, posing further challenges.
- Growth of mega-carriers: The consolidation of the trucking industry has led to larger fleets utilizing larger vehicles.
Infrastructure Limitations
America's existing road and bridge infrastructure wasn't designed to handle the sheer size and weight of many trucks currently on the road. This mismatch leads to several issues:
- Road damage: The constant pounding of heavy trucks causes significant damage to roads, requiring expensive and frequent repairs.
- Bridge weight restrictions: Many bridges are structurally inadequate to support the increasing weight of modern trucks, necessitating detours or costly reinforcement.
- Increased maintenance costs: The strain on infrastructure translates into massive increases in maintenance and repair costs for taxpayers.
- Traffic congestion caused by oversized trucks: Oversized trucks often contribute to traffic congestion, further slowing down transportation and increasing fuel consumption. Obtaining oversize truck permits can be a lengthy process further complicating the logistics.
The limitations of road infrastructure and bridge weight limits are severely impacting the efficiency and safety of our transportation systems.
Regulatory Challenges
Existing regulations governing truck weight regulations and vehicle sizes vary significantly across states, creating inconsistencies and loopholes. This lack of uniformity and effective enforcement makes it challenging to effectively manage the truck size problem.
- Variations in state regulations: Differences in state laws make it difficult to establish a consistent national standard for truck size and weight.
- Lack of federal standards enforcement: Weak enforcement of existing federal regulations allows some operators to exceed weight limits with impunity.
- Difficulty in monitoring oversized vehicles: Monitoring and tracking oversized vehicles requires advanced technologies and dedicated resources, often lacking in many areas. This makes it difficult to fully utilize oversize load permits.
Addressing these regulatory challenges requires a cohesive national approach to federal trucking regulations.
Potential Solutions to the Truck Size Problem
Tackling America's truck size problem demands a multi-pronged approach, combining infrastructure improvements, stricter regulations, and innovative transportation solutions.
Investing in Infrastructure Improvements
Significant investment in upgrading roads, bridges, and other essential infrastructure is paramount. This includes:
- Funding for highway expansion: Expanding highway capacity can alleviate congestion and reduce the strain on existing roads.
- Bridge strengthening: Strengthening or replacing outdated bridges is crucial for ensuring safe passage for heavier vehicles.
- Improved traffic management systems: Implementing advanced traffic management systems can optimize traffic flow and reduce congestion. This essential infrastructure investment will improve safety and efficiency, creating smart highways better equipped for the demands of modern trucking.
Implementing Stricter Regulations and Enforcement
Enhancing regulations and strengthening their enforcement is essential. This includes:
- National truck size standards: Establishing consistent national standards for truck size and weight will create a level playing field for all operators.
- Enhanced monitoring technologies: Implementing advanced monitoring technologies, such as weight-in-motion systems, can help improve enforcement.
- Increased penalties for violations: Significantly increasing penalties for violations will deter operators from exceeding weight limits and endangering public safety. Stricter truck weight limits and robust trucking regulation enforcement are critical steps.
Promoting Alternative Transportation Methods
Diverting freight from roads to other transportation modes can significantly alleviate pressure on the highway system. This includes:
- Investment in rail infrastructure: Investing in modernizing rail infrastructure can make it a more competitive and efficient alternative to trucking.
- Improved intermodal transportation: Improving intermodal transportation systems can facilitate seamless transfer of goods between different modes of transport.
- Promoting the use of inland waterways: Utilizing inland waterways, where feasible, can further reduce road congestion. This is key to creating sustainable trucking solutions.
Technological Advancements
Technological advancements hold great promise in addressing the truck size problem:
- Autonomous trucking: Autonomous trucks could improve efficiency and reduce accidents through better route planning and driverless operation.
- Truck platooning: Platooning, where trucks travel in close formation, can reduce fuel consumption and improve aerodynamic efficiency.
- Lighter-weight truck materials: Utilizing lighter-weight materials in truck construction can reduce their overall weight and the strain on infrastructure.
- Improved fuel efficiency technologies: Investing in technologies to improve fuel efficiency can reduce environmental impact and operating costs. These fuel-efficient trucks are essential to a sustainable transportation future.
